SlideShare a Scribd company logo
1 of 3
Code help for Menu, pop up menu

If Button = vbRightButton Then PopupMenu Me.mnuPopup




Private txtName_MouseUp(Button As Integer, Shift As Integer, X As Single, Y As
Single)

If Button=vbRightButton Then

PopupMenu mnuEdit

End If

End Sub



How do I find out what menu item was clicked

str = popMenu.Name
Select Case str
Case "mCut"
MsgBox "cut"
Case "mPaste"
MsgBox "paste"
Case "mProperties"
MsgBox "pro"

End Select



Popup menu coding

         Private Sub lblTestText_MouseDown(Button As Integer, _
                                           Shift As Integer, _
                                           X As Single, _
                                           Y As Single)

             If Button = vbRightButton Then
                 PopupMenu mnuPopUpFormat, vbPopupMenuRightButton
             End If

         End Sub
Code for bold
      Private Sub mnuBold_Click()

           If mnuBold.Checked Then
                lblTestText.FontBold = False
                mnuBold.Checked = False
           Else
                lblTestText.FontBold = True
                mnuBold.Checked = True
           End If

      End Sub

Code the mnuItalic_Click and mnuUnderline_Click events in a similar fashion as shown
      below.
      Private Sub mnuItalic_Click()

           If mnuItalic.Checked Then
                lblTestText.FontItalic = False
                mnuItalic.Checked = False
           Else
                lblTestText.FontItalic = True
                mnuItalic.Checked = True
           End If

      End Sub

      Private Sub mnuUnderline_Click()

           If mnuUnderline.Checked Then
                lblTestText.FontUnderline = False
                mnuUnderline.Checked = False
           Else
                lblTestText.FontUnderline = True
                mnuUnderline.Checked = True
           End If

      End Sub




MsgBox "Code for 'Print' goes here.", vbInformation, "Menu Demo"



      Private Sub mnuBold_Click()
      If mnuBold.Checked Then
      lblTestText.FontBold = False
      mnuBold.Checked = False
Else
lblTestText.FontBold = True
mnuBold.Checked = True
End If
End Sub

More Related Content

Viewers also liked

Presentation on telnet
Presentation on telnetPresentation on telnet
Presentation on telnetAmandeep Kaur
 
Introduction to visual basic programming
Introduction to visual basic programmingIntroduction to visual basic programming
Introduction to visual basic programmingRoger Argarin
 
TCP/IP Network ppt
TCP/IP Network pptTCP/IP Network ppt
TCP/IP Network pptextraganesh
 
Internet protocol (ip) ppt
Internet protocol (ip) pptInternet protocol (ip) ppt
Internet protocol (ip) pptDulith Kasun
 
Visual basic ppt for tutorials computer
Visual basic ppt for tutorials computerVisual basic ppt for tutorials computer
Visual basic ppt for tutorials computersimran153
 
Visual Basic Codes And Screen Designs
Visual Basic Codes And Screen DesignsVisual Basic Codes And Screen Designs
Visual Basic Codes And Screen Designsprcastano
 

Viewers also liked (14)

VB Codes
VB CodesVB Codes
VB Codes
 
Standard Algorithms
Standard AlgorithmsStandard Algorithms
Standard Algorithms
 
Vb file
Vb fileVb file
Vb file
 
The Best Source Code VB
The Best Source Code VBThe Best Source Code VB
The Best Source Code VB
 
TELNET Protocol
TELNET ProtocolTELNET Protocol
TELNET Protocol
 
Visual Basic 6.0
Visual Basic 6.0Visual Basic 6.0
Visual Basic 6.0
 
Presentation on telnet
Presentation on telnetPresentation on telnet
Presentation on telnet
 
Ip address
Ip addressIp address
Ip address
 
Introduction to visual basic programming
Introduction to visual basic programmingIntroduction to visual basic programming
Introduction to visual basic programming
 
Ip address and subnetting
Ip address and subnettingIp address and subnetting
Ip address and subnetting
 
TCP/IP Network ppt
TCP/IP Network pptTCP/IP Network ppt
TCP/IP Network ppt
 
Internet protocol (ip) ppt
Internet protocol (ip) pptInternet protocol (ip) ppt
Internet protocol (ip) ppt
 
Visual basic ppt for tutorials computer
Visual basic ppt for tutorials computerVisual basic ppt for tutorials computer
Visual basic ppt for tutorials computer
 
Visual Basic Codes And Screen Designs
Visual Basic Codes And Screen DesignsVisual Basic Codes And Screen Designs
Visual Basic Codes And Screen Designs
 

More from Amandeep Kaur

Video/ Graphics cards
Video/ Graphics  cardsVideo/ Graphics  cards
Video/ Graphics cardsAmandeep Kaur
 
Menu pop up menu mdi form and playing audio in vb
Menu pop up menu mdi form and playing audio in vbMenu pop up menu mdi form and playing audio in vb
Menu pop up menu mdi form and playing audio in vbAmandeep Kaur
 
Image contro, and format functions in vb
Image contro, and format functions in vbImage contro, and format functions in vb
Image contro, and format functions in vbAmandeep Kaur
 
Data base connectivity and flex grid in vb
Data base connectivity and flex grid in vbData base connectivity and flex grid in vb
Data base connectivity and flex grid in vbAmandeep Kaur
 
Toolbar, statusbar, coolbar in vb
Toolbar, statusbar, coolbar in vbToolbar, statusbar, coolbar in vb
Toolbar, statusbar, coolbar in vbAmandeep Kaur
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phicsAmandeep Kaur
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phicsAmandeep Kaur
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phicsAmandeep Kaur
 
Report on browser war
Report on browser warReport on browser war
Report on browser warAmandeep Kaur
 
Report of internet connections
Report of internet connectionsReport of internet connections
Report of internet connectionsAmandeep Kaur
 
How to configure dns server(2)
How to configure dns server(2)How to configure dns server(2)
How to configure dns server(2)Amandeep Kaur
 

More from Amandeep Kaur (20)

Video/ Graphics cards
Video/ Graphics  cardsVideo/ Graphics  cards
Video/ Graphics cards
 
Menu pop up menu mdi form and playing audio in vb
Menu pop up menu mdi form and playing audio in vbMenu pop up menu mdi form and playing audio in vb
Menu pop up menu mdi form and playing audio in vb
 
Active x control
Active x controlActive x control
Active x control
 
Image contro, and format functions in vb
Image contro, and format functions in vbImage contro, and format functions in vb
Image contro, and format functions in vb
 
Data base connectivity and flex grid in vb
Data base connectivity and flex grid in vbData base connectivity and flex grid in vb
Data base connectivity and flex grid in vb
 
Toolbar, statusbar, coolbar in vb
Toolbar, statusbar, coolbar in vbToolbar, statusbar, coolbar in vb
Toolbar, statusbar, coolbar in vb
 
Richtextbox
RichtextboxRichtextbox
Richtextbox
 
Treeview listview
Treeview listviewTreeview listview
Treeview listview
 
Progress bar
Progress barProgress bar
Progress bar
 
Socket
SocketSocket
Socket
 
Ppt of socket
Ppt of socketPpt of socket
Ppt of socket
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phics
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phics
 
Introduction to computer graphics
Introduction to computer graphicsIntroduction to computer graphics
Introduction to computer graphics
 
Internet
InternetInternet
Internet
 
Internet working
Internet workingInternet working
Internet working
 
Report on browser war
Report on browser warReport on browser war
Report on browser war
 
Report of internet connections
Report of internet connectionsReport of internet connections
Report of internet connections
 
Report on intranet
Report on intranetReport on intranet
Report on intranet
 
How to configure dns server(2)
How to configure dns server(2)How to configure dns server(2)
How to configure dns server(2)
 

Menu vb

  • 1. Code help for Menu, pop up menu If Button = vbRightButton Then PopupMenu Me.mnuPopup Private txtName_MouseUp(Button As Integer, Shift As Integer, X As Single, Y As Single) If Button=vbRightButton Then PopupMenu mnuEdit End If End Sub How do I find out what menu item was clicked str = popMenu.Name Select Case str Case "mCut" MsgBox "cut" Case "mPaste" MsgBox "paste" Case "mProperties" MsgBox "pro" End Select Popup menu coding Private Sub lblTestText_MouseDown(Button As Integer, _ Shift As Integer, _ X As Single, _ Y As Single) If Button = vbRightButton Then PopupMenu mnuPopUpFormat, vbPopupMenuRightButton End If End Sub
  • 2. Code for bold Private Sub mnuBold_Click() If mnuBold.Checked Then lblTestText.FontBold = False mnuBold.Checked = False Else lblTestText.FontBold = True mnuBold.Checked = True End If End Sub Code the mnuItalic_Click and mnuUnderline_Click events in a similar fashion as shown below. Private Sub mnuItalic_Click() If mnuItalic.Checked Then lblTestText.FontItalic = False mnuItalic.Checked = False Else lblTestText.FontItalic = True mnuItalic.Checked = True End If End Sub Private Sub mnuUnderline_Click() If mnuUnderline.Checked Then lblTestText.FontUnderline = False mnuUnderline.Checked = False Else lblTestText.FontUnderline = True mnuUnderline.Checked = True End If End Sub MsgBox "Code for 'Print' goes here.", vbInformation, "Menu Demo" Private Sub mnuBold_Click() If mnuBold.Checked Then lblTestText.FontBold = False mnuBold.Checked = False